Revenue and income statement

In 2017, ATELIER ARCHITECTURE FELIX achieves revenue of 424 k€. Slight decline of -7% vs 2016.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 424 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 16 k€, representing 3.7%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(-7%), EBITDA varies by -56%, reducing margin by 4.2 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 11 k€, i.e. 2.7%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 78%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 41%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 5.4 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This ratio remains within usual banking standards. Cash flow represents 3.6%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 141 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 25 days. The gap of 116 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Overall, WCR represents 160 days of revenue, i.e. 188 k€ to permanently finance.
